^(60)Co-γ辐照对越南油茶种子发芽及幼苗生长的影响 被引量:5

Effects of ^(60)Co-γ Irradiation on Seed Germination and Seedling Growth of Camellia drupifera

摘要 试验选取越南油茶"璠龙3号"(Camellia drupifera‘Fanlong 3’)、"璠龙4号"(C.drupifera‘fanlong 4’)和"璠龙5号"(C.ddrupifera‘Fanlong 5’)优树的种子进行^(60)Co-γ射线处理,研究0、10、20、30 Gy辐照对种子发芽率、出苗率和幼苗苗高、叶长、叶宽、叶面积以及叶片总叶绿素含量的影响。结果表明,辐射对"璠龙3号"、"璠龙4号"优树种子发芽具有促进作用;30 Gy辐射处理的种子出苗率在各处理中最低,"璠龙3号"、"璠龙4号"、"璠龙5号"优树种子的出苗率分别为74.44%、72.86%和66.67%;^(60)Co-γ辐射一定程度上抑制了越南油茶"璠龙"幼苗的高生长,对3个无性系幼苗的叶长、叶宽和叶面积生长影响不显著;^(60)Co-γ辐射对3个无性系叶片总叶绿素含量的影响较明显,表现为总叶绿素含量降低。 Seeds of Camellia drupifera‘Fanlong3’,C.drupifera‘Fanlong4’and C.drupifera‘Fanlong5’were selected for60Co-γradiation treatment.The effects of0,10,20and30Gy irradiation on seed germination rate,emergence rate,seedling height,leaf length,leaf width,leaf area,and the total chlorophyllcontent of leaf were studied.The results showed that radiation could promot the seed germination of C.drupifera‘Fanlong3’and C.drupifera‘Fanlong4’.The seed germination rate of30Gy radiation treatment was thelowest among the treatments,and the germination rate of the C.drupifera‘Fanlong3’,C.drupifera‘Fanlong4’,and C.drupifera‘Fanlong5’were74.44%,72.86%,and66.67%,respectively.60Co-γradiation inhibitedthe seedling height growth of‘Fanlong’seedlings in a certain extent,and had no significant effects on leaf length,leaf width and leaf area growth of three clones.The effect of60Co-γradiation on chlorophyll content of three C.drupifera clones was obvious that the content of total chlorophyll decreased.
